Wine review: Ampersand Estates Chardonnay 2024

Recently, I was sent some wines from Ampersand Estates, and I was particularly excited to crack open their Ampersand Estates Chardonnay 2024. If you’re after a Summery Chardonnay that is super refreshing, this one is perfect for you! It’s definitely more of a mineral style of Chardonnay, which makes it great for enjoying in warmer weather. But it’s also got plenty to unpack, with lots of refinement and elegance that make it a great food wine.

From the first pour, the Ampersand Estates Chardonnay 2024 is beautifully aromatic, with notes of peach and grapefruit alongside hints of lime and ginger. On the palate, it’s crisp and lively, with a punchy citrus core that gives the wine plenty of energy. Flavours of peach and lemon curd come through clearly, finishing with a refreshing, slightly chalky texture that keeps you coming back for another sip. This is a fantastic food wine perfect with white fish, roast chicken or fresh goat’s cheese. But honestly, it’s just as lovely to enjoy on its own over a long lunch or at sunset with a chilled glass in hand.

About Ampersand Estates

Nestled in WA’s beautiful Pemberton region, Ampersand Estate is a place where premium wine, thoughtful design and a deep sense of connection come together effortlessly. Set among the cool-climate beauty of the Southern Forests, every bottle captures a moment in time: sun-soaked afternoons, drifting mist and the gentle rhythm of vineyard life. Refined yet generous, Ampersand’s wines are shaped by nature and crafted with intent, designed to be shared over long lunches, cosy fireside evenings or celebrations that linger well into the night.

Founded in 2020 by Melissa Bell and Corrie Scheepers, Ampersand Estate was born from a shared vision to reimagine the region’s oldest winery into something truly special. With roots spanning the United States and South Africa, the duo brought bold creativity and entrepreneurial spirit to the historic property, transforming it into one of Australia’s top 10 winery stays.
